Joe Scarborough went on an lengthy rant Thursday on “Morning Joe” insisting, “I want a rock rib conservative that can kick ass and not only win elections but can take this country back and a mellow dude who happened to know how to get conjoined twins taken apart, that’s not the ticket” referring to Ben Carson.

Scarborough’s rant began after clips from a Bloomberg focus group played where people voiced strong support for the neurosurgeon turned presidential candidate.

However, Scarborough doesn’t agree with Carson’s appeal suggesting, “I still have a blind spot about Ben Carson. I have seen guys and women running for City Council in Pensacola, Florida who were good people, who got in there and because they didn’t know how to govern, they had no experience, they didn’t know how to negotiate, they didn’t know how to do deals they didn’t know how to work with other people, they didn’t know how to handle constituent services, that on a local level in Pensacola, Florida, they were a disaster.” (RELATED: Carson: Islam Is Not Consistent With The Constitution)

Scarborough made the comparison explaining, “I have seen people on school boards that were good, Christian people. That got elected because they were good, Christian people. They went on school boards and ended up with grand juries coming after them not because they were bad people but because they were so over their heads on the Escambia County school board!” (RELATED: Ben Carson Unable To Explain Stance On Debt Limit)

Scarborough continued, “And people are looking at this guy and saying he’s a good, decent, Christian guy and they are ready for him to be President of the United States. I am sorry, I’m going to stop right here. And I’m not going to get on this train where I say I understand why people would vote for Ben Carson as President of the United States. And I can tell you, we’re going down a dangerous path as a party and a dangerous path as a country if we Republicans or Democrats start electing people because they’re nice Christian folk.”

Later in Thursday’s show Scarborough insisted, “I know there are a couple of idiots that are going to say, ‘Ohh, Manhattan elites and Joe Scarborough, da da da da.’ No, all of these people [in the focus groups], I know them. They all voted for me. And quite frankly if I ran again they would vote for me again despite what I’m saying right now about Ben Carson. I’m not being an elitist when I say Ben Carson is not qualified to be President of the United States. I don’t get why they aren’t talking about someone who can actually get us out of the mess — I say this as a Republican — Barack Obama has put us in.”

Scarborough concluded his rant explaining, “This is not about me not getting my party. I don’t want it to be a moderate party, I don’t want it to be a Rockefeller. I want a rock rib conservative that can kick ass and not only win elections but can take this country back and a mellow dude who happened to know how to get conjoined twins taken apart, that’s not the ticket.”
